Skip to content
+44(0)7931781242
LISTEN TO PODCAST
Home
About Tesse
Podcasts
Blog
Leadership
Home
About Tesse
Podcasts
Blog
Leadership
+44(0)7931781242
LISTEN TO PODCAST
Home
About Tesse
Podcasts
Blog
Leadership
Home
About Tesse
Podcasts
Blog
Leadership
Home
About Tesse
Podcasts
Blog
Leadership
Home
About Tesse
Podcasts
Blog
Leadership